When Does Apple Kenwood Actually Open?
Most days, the Apple Store at Kenwood Towne Centre opens its doors at 10:00 AM.

If you’re a mall walker, the mall itself usually lets people in as early as 10:00 AM on Monday through Saturday (and 11:00 AM on Sundays), though some entrances like the one near The Cheesecake Factory or Nordstrom might have security guards cracking the doors a few minutes early. Apple, however, stays pretty strict. They usually won't let you past the threshold until that clock hits 10:00 sharp.
Here is the standard weekly breakdown for 2026:
- Monday – Thursday: 10:00 AM to 8:00 PM
- Friday – Saturday: 10:00 AM to 9:00 PM
- Sunday: 12:00 PM to 6:00 PM (Sometimes 11:00 AM depending on seasonal shifts)
You've probably noticed that Sunday is the "short day." If you roll up at 7:00 PM on a Sunday evening thinking you’ll just "pop in," you’re going to be staring at a closed gate. It’s kinda frustrating, but that’s the mall life.
The Genius Bar Factor
The biggest mistake people make? Assuming the Genius Bar is open just because the store is. Technically, yes, they are staffed during store hours, but that doesn't mean they can see you. If you show up at 7:45 PM on a Tuesday without an appointment, the chances of a technician looking at your MacBook are slim to none.
I’ve seen people wait two hours for a "walk-in" slot only to be told to come back the next day. It’s brutal.
If you need a repair, you basically have to use the Apple Support app to book a slot. Those slots refresh in the middle of the night—usually around 6:00 AM or 7:00 AM local time. If you’re desperate, check the app right when you wake up. You might snag a cancellation for that afternoon.

Holiday Shifts and Special Events
Apple follows the Kenwood Towne Centre mall schedule for major holidays. This means:
- Closed: Thanksgiving Day and Christmas Day.
- Modified: On days like New Year’s Day or Labor Day, the store might close early, often around 6:00 PM.
- Extended: During the "Black Friday" season in late November, the store often opens as early as 8:00 AM.
Always check the official Apple website or the mall’s primary directory if it's a federal holiday. There’s nothing worse than driving all the way to Sycamore Township just to find the lights off.

What Most People Get Wrong
A lot of people think they can just drop off a device for repair and pick it up an hour later. That rarely happens at Kenwood anymore. Because it’s one of the busiest stores in the region, even "simple" battery replacements might be quoted as a 3-5 hour wait or even an overnight stay if they're backed up.
Also, don't forget your ID. If you’re picking up an online order or a repaired device, they won't give it to you without a government-issued photo ID that matches the name on the order. No exceptions. They're pretty hardcore about that.
Actionable Steps for Your Visit
- Book First: Use the Apple Support app to schedule a Genius Bar appointment at least 3 days in advance if possible.
- Check Stock: If you’re looking for a specific iPad or Mac configuration, use the "Pick up in store" option on Apple's website before you leave the house. This "locks" the inventory for you.
- Back Up Everything: If you're going for a repair, back up to iCloud or a hard drive at home. They will ask you if you've done this, and if you haven't, you might have to sit there for an hour doing it on their Wi-Fi.
- Parking Strategy: Use the Nordstrom-side parking deck. It’s the fastest route to the second floor and puts you right by the store entrance.
